Now my band isn't one alot of teenage girls are into, (most don't know who they are) but these guys are my life. They are The Arrogant Worms. For those who have never heard of them, (which I think would be most) they are a Candian comedy folk group (though they parody lots of different genres of music) who sing about things like cows, sponges and the murderous ways of eating vegetables.
